Understanding the Core Progression Loop

The main progression system in Anime Capture is built around a straightforward gameplay cycle. You defeat enemies to earn Crystals and other resources, use those resources to capture anime-inspired characters, assign the strongest captured characters to your active team, and then advance into tougher worlds where even stronger units await. Every action you take should feed directly back into this loop.

Core Loop Priority

Always ask yourself: "Does this action make my active team stronger right now?" If the answer is no, redirect your time to farming enemies, completing quests, or capturing upgrades.

Progression Loop Breakdown

PhaseActionPrimary Goal
CombatDefeat enemies quicklyEarn Crystals and unlock capture attempts
CaptureTarget defeated charactersAdd stronger units to your collection
Team BuildingEquip best captured unitsMaximize active team damage output
UpgradeSpend Crystals on main teamIncrease clear speed for current world
AdvanceMove to next worldAccess higher-rarity characters and rewards

The speed of your progression is directly tied to how efficiently you complete each phase. Players who stall in early areas often spread their resources too thin across too many characters, rather than concentrating their upgrades on a core team.

Step-by-Step Fastest Progression Route

Follow this sequence to minimize wasted time and maximize your team's power growth from the start of your session through mid-game advancement.

1

Redeem Launch Codes

Before engaging in combat, open the codes menu and enter RELEASE to claim your free rewards. These resources give you an immediate head start on your first upgrades.

2

Farm the Starting Area

Target the weakest enemies in your starting world and defeat them repeatedly. Prioritize clear speed over enemy difficulty — you want to generate Crystals and unlock capture opportunities as fast as possible.

3

Capture Your First Team

After defeating enemies, use the capture system to obtain characters. Fill all available team slots with the strongest options you can capture, even if they are only early-game units.

4

Concentrate All Upgrades

Direct every Crystal and upgrade resource into the single strongest damage dealer on your team. Do not upgrade evenly — one powerful carry unit will dramatically reduce your clear times.

5

Push Quests Simultaneously

While farming enemies, work toward quest objectives that align with your current activity. Quests reward you for actions you are already performing and provide bonus resources that accelerate your next upgrades.

6

Advance to the Next World

Once your carry unit defeats current-area enemies comfortably, move forward immediately. Do not overfarm weak enemies — new worlds offer stronger captures that make previous units obsolete.

Momentum Is Key

The fastest progression route relies on maintaining forward momentum. Every minute spent over-farming an area you already clear easily is a minute lost on capturing stronger units in the next world.

Crystal Farming and Resource Management

Crystals serve as the primary currency in Anime Capture. You earn them by defeating enemies and completing quests, and you spend them on upgrades that directly impact your team's combat effectiveness. Efficient Crystal management separates fast progressors from players who stall in mid-game content.

Crystal Spending Priorities

PrioritySpending CategoryRecommended AllocationReason
HighestMain carry unit upgrades50-60%Directly increases clear speed
HighSecondary team upgrades20-25%Supports overall team damage
MediumTime Chamber investments10-15%Passive progression during downtime
LowReserve stockpile5-10%Saved for stronger future captures
AvoidUpgrading collection units0%Units outside active team provide no combat value
Resource Discipline

Never upgrade characters that are not in your active team. Every Crystal spent on a collection unit is a Crystal stolen from your main progression path. Save your resources for units that actually participate in combat.

Farming Efficiency Comparison

Farming MethodCrystal RateCapture OpportunitiesRecommended For
Fast enemy clears (weak area)ModerateLowEarly game, quick sessions
On-level enemy farmingHighMediumCore progression, balanced approach
Quest-focused farmingVariableVariablePlayers needing structured goals
Time Chamber (passive)LowNoneSupplementing active play sessions

The most efficient approach combines on-level enemy farming with quest completion. This method maximizes both Crystal income and capture opportunities while ensuring you always have a clear progression goal.

Team Building and Capture Strategy

Building a strong team requires discipline in two areas: capturing the right characters and deciding which units deserve your limited team slots. Because team space is restricted, every slot must contribute meaningful damage to your current progression tier.

Unit Tier Value Reference

TierRoleBest Used ForUpgrade Investment
S TierHighest rarity capturesLate-game worlds, difficult enemiesMaximum priority
A TierStrong general performersCore progression, resource farmingHigh priority
B TierEarly-to-mid progressionFilling gaps until stronger captures arriveModerate investment
C TierStarter and low-value unitsVery early game onlyMinimal, replace quickly

Capture Decision Framework

Before investing resources into a newly captured character, compare its rarity and damage output against your weakest active team member. Only upgrade if the new unit provides a clear, measurable improvement.

Team Slot Protection

Your active team slots are more valuable than your collection size. Reserve every slot for the strongest characters available in your current progression tier and replace underperformers immediately.

Efficient Capture Targeting

A target you can defeat repeatedly at high speed is more valuable for capture farming than a strong enemy that takes too long to kill. Prioritize capture efficiency over capture difficulty.

When to Replace Units

SignalActionResource Impact
New world offers higher-rarity charactersCapture and equip immediatelyShift all upgrades to new unit
Current unit takes too long to clear enemiesReplace with stronger captureStop investing in old unit
Team damage feels insufficient for areaCapture from current or previous worldRebalance upgrade spending
Quest rewards provide free charactersEvaluate against active teamEquip if stronger, ignore if weaker

Common Progression Mistakes to Avoid

Even experienced players can slow their progression by falling into predictable traps. Recognizing these patterns early helps maintain a fast, efficient advancement pace through Anime Capture's worlds.

Progression Mistakes and Corrections

MistakeWhy It Slows You DownCorrect Approach
Upgrading every captured unitSpreads Crystals too thin, weakens main teamInvest only in active team members
Overfarming easy enemiesWastes time on low-value targetsMove forward when clears are comfortable
Ignoring questsMisses structured rewards and directionCheck quest log during every farming session
Keeping weak units in team slotsReduces overall team damage outputReplace immediately when stronger captures appear
Skipping the Time ChamberLoses passive progression during downtimeAlways run Time Chamber between sessions
Hoarding Crystals without spendingDelays power spikes that speed up farmingSpend on main carry unit as resources accumulate
The Overfarm Trap

The most common progression killer is staying in an area long after your team can clear it easily. If enemies die in seconds, you should already be moving to the next world. Comfortable clears are a signal to advance, not to settle in.
